IT System Administrator Hybrid - 3 days per week in office
Salary up to £29,000
Are you ready to play a pivotal role in delivering and improving IT services within a dynamic business environment? We are seeking a skilled IT System Administrator to provide comprehensive support across our clients organisation, ensuring delivery of reliable and effective IT services.
Key Responsibilities
- Deliver group-wide IT services, maintaining agreed service levels and prioritising responses for optimal business support.
- Act as an escalation point for service desk analysts and business users, providing timely solutions and minimising repeat issues by analysing trends and behaviours.
- Define, document, and evolve service processes, the Service Catalogue, and SLAs, ensuring alignment with best practice and IT policies.
- Provide expert desktop and server support, including hardware configuration, upgrades, and installation of new service packs or software.
- Manage routine repairs, upgrades and effectively respond to system faults or failures, ensuring these are documented and escalated appropriately.
- Keep the asset management database accurate and up to date.
- Monitor system performance and report on service delivery metrics, exploring opportunities to improve customer satisfaction.
- Support the management and maintenance of distributed IT equipment and infrastructure, ensuring it meets evolving business requirements.
- Log and update service desk calls promptly, ensuring regular, clear communication with users.
- Provide meeting room technology support and education for end users.
- Ensure adherence to IT service controls, regulatory standards, and organisational policies.
- Collaborate with all IT teams to ensure the successful implementation and documentation of new or updated services.
- Undertake ad hoc projects and departmental duties as required.
Essential Skills and Experience
- Excellent customer service skills and a drive to satisfy IT service users.
- Ability to translate complex technical topics into clear, accessible language.
- Strong decision-making skills, with a focus on developing timely and effective solutions.
- Meticulous attention to detail and a continuous improvement mindset.
- Analytical skills for diagnosing, testing, and implementing solutions in line with best practice.
- Ability to prioritise workload and manage multiple demands in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ment.
Technical Proficiency
- Detailed knowledge of Microsoft Active Directory and Entra.
- Experience in group policy implementation and administration.
- Proven track record with IT systems, infrastructure, and emerging technologies.
- Network management (including TCP/IP, DNS), server/hardware maintenance, and workstation deployment.
- Familiarity with automated deployment tools and IT service management frameworks.
